Meaning and Usage

"노트" primarily refers to a notebook or notes taken on paper. It is commonly used to describe a physical notebook for writing down information, such as during classes or meetings. Additionally, "노트" is also used as a short form for "노트북 컴퓨터," meaning a laptop computer.

Common Collocations

  • 노트에 적다: to write in a notebook, used when recording information.
  • 노트북 컴퓨터: laptop computer, a common loanword in Korean.
  • 노트 정리하다: to organize notes, often used by students.

Register and Usage Notes

"노트" is a casual and widely understood term, suitable for everyday conversation and formal contexts like school or work. When referring to a laptop, "노트북" is more precise, but "노트" alone can sometimes be understood in context.

Common Mistakes

Learners sometimes confuse "노트" with "노트북." Remember that "노트" alone usually means a notebook or notes, while "노트북" specifically means a laptop computer. Avoid dropping "북" when you want to talk about a laptop to prevent confusion.

Example Sentences

수업 시간에 중요한 내용을 노트에 적었어요.

Su-eop sigane jungyohan naeyongeul noteue jeogeosseoyo.

I wrote important content in my notebook during class.

노트북 컴퓨터를 새로 샀어요.

Noteubuk keompyuteoreul saero sasseoyo.

I bought a new laptop computer.

회의 내용을 노트에 꼼꼼히 기록하세요.

Hoeui naeyongeul noteue kkomkkomhi girokaseyo.

Please carefully record the meeting contents in your notes.
